catachresis

noun
  • Such a misuse involving some similarity of sound between the misused word and the appropriate word. 

  • A misapplication or overextension of figurative or analogical description; a wrongly applied metaphor or trope. 

  • A misuse of a word; an application of a term to something which it does not properly denote. 

vulgarism

noun
  • A spelling, word, or phrase used in common speech that is considered improper or incorrect for formal communication. 

  • Editors of newspapers allow more vulgarisms to go to print today than they used to. 

  • A word or term that is considered offensive or vulgar.
